Home » 6 Easy Ways to Become a MERN Stack Developer

6 Easy Ways to Become a MERN Stack Developer

by shams011
MERN Stack Training

Introduction

MERN stack development is a rewarding career with a bright future. But how does one become a MERN Stack Developer? What technologies must you master, and in what order? This article will teach you about the different components of and the essential steps to becoming a MERN Stack Developer. Alternatively, you can enroll in the MERN Stack Online Training and understand its components. Such training will also help you to enter the professional world with great expertise.

MERN Stack: Meaning

MERN stands for MongoDB, Express.js, React, and Node.js. Nodejs and Express are used to build the backend, whereas React is for the front end, and MongoDB is used to store data. However, there are other prominent stacks, such as MEAN and MEVN, but MERN remains the most popular and developer-friendly tech stack due to the inclusion of React.

React is the most popular library in web development and is used to develop the front end of an application. It boosts the site’s performance by making user interface development easier.

When combining React with MongoDB, Express.js, and Node.js, the stack transforms into a highly flexible and open-source JavaScript-based technology suit.

Steps to Become a MERN Stack Developer

Being a MERN Stack developer may appear intimidating with the inclusion of so many distinct components. However, it may be tough to understand what you need to learn and in which sequence. As a result, here are the crucial steps you must follow to become a MERN Stack Developer.

Step 1: Learn the Basis Language of Front End Development

If you work in the Web Development industry or wish to pursue a career as a web developer, you must first understand the three fundamental languages HTML, CSS, and JavaScript. Thus, learning these languages will assist you in understanding the principles of Web development and how these languages function.

  • HTML is an abbreviation for Hypertext Markup Language. It is a standard markup language used to define the structure of a Web page. It instructs the browser on how to display material on a web page.
  • CSS is a language used to style a website’s text, color, buttons, and tables. It also helps to organize its pages. Moreover, CSS provides for the separation of information and formatting, allowing web pages to adapt to different types of devices of varying sizes.
  • JavaScript is a programming language that you can use to program the behavior of web pages to make them more dynamic and interactive.

Step 2: Understand the Usage of Front End Tools

After understanding the fundamental three languages, you may go on to study the tools that will help you develop the front end quicker. Here are a few tools that will help you to create applications.

  1. Microsoft Visual Studio Code
  2. Git
  3. SASS
  4. BootStrap

Step 3: Understand the Basis of Web Design

Once you’ve mastered the technical aspects of front-end web development and learn how to utilize its tools, you may go to the next phase. In this step, you can investigate the design component of website building. Web design is the process of creating the overall look and feel of a website using diverse colors, fonts, and layouts. However, the primary objective of web design is to develop a responsive, entertaining, appealing, and user-friendly website so that users will stay on the site for a long time.

Step 4: Learn React

The next stage is to learn how to utilize React. It is an open-source front-end technology designed by Facebook. However, there are several methods you may learn React. If you choose to study at your own pace, you can refer to several online resources accessible for self-learners. Also, you can refer to the official documentation for React and an in-depth tutorial to assist you to learn how to use the framework and its different abilities. On the other hand, if you prefer to study through video teaching, YouTube has several options for you.

Step 5: Learn the Back End part of MERN Stack

Till now, you have mastered the MERN stack’s Front End. Now, it’s time to get acquainted with the Back End, which contains Express.js, Node.js, and MongoDB.

  • js is a framework for creating an application’s backend. It operates within Node.js and helps to develop single-page and hybrid web apps.
  • js is a JavaScript runtime environment. It is open-source and free to use. However, it enables you to run JavaScript programs outside a web browser and develop highly scalable server-side applications with little or no effort.
  • MongoDB is a NoSQL database. You can use it as an alternative to traditional relational databases. Also, it enables you to store data and operate with it effectively.

Step 6: Practice and Improve your Skills

At last, you now have all the necessary skills to work as a MERN stack developer. All that remains is to continue training and enhance your skills. Take on small projects to keep growing your skillset and gaining confidence in your ability. With time, you’ll acquire the skills and confidence to get your first job as a MERN Stack Developer.

Conclusion

Finally, learning all these technologies may somewhat be a challenging task. However, you must take out time and study the basics first. Don’t jump directly to understand React and Node.js. Instead, learn HTML, CSS, and JavaScript if you want to understand these libraries and frameworks. Alternatively, you can take the help of MERN Stack Developer Training in Noida to gain competency in MERN stack technologies.

Related Videos

Leave a Comment